Lewis J. Yedinak, Sr., (Joe)

Age 62, of Elkton, MD, passed away April 29, 2011, at Union Hospital surrounded by his family.

Born in Elkton, MD on January 1, 1949, Joe was the son of the late Henry and Katherine Demond Yedinak. He was a 1968 graduate of Elkton High School. He was retired from AMTRAK and was an active member of Moose Lodge 851 for 35 years. Joe genuinely enjoyed life, especially gardening and horses. A devoted family man, he adored his grandchildren. Joe will be dearly missed by his family and many friends.

He is survived by his wife 42 years, Donna Yedinak of Elkton; two children, Joseph Yedinak, Jr. of Elkton and Michael Yedinak and wife Michele of Elkton; four grandchildren, Jordyn Yedinak, Abby Neal, Paige and Connor Yedinak. He also leaves behind three sisters, Patricia Charshee, Brenda Hunt, Diane Moon and a brother John Yedinak as well as nieces, nephews and in laws. He was preceded in death by his sister Carole Dorsey.

A service honoring Joe's life will be held at R.T. Foard Funeral Home, P.A. (formerly Gee Funeral Home), 259 East Main St., Elkton, MD 21921 on Thursday May 5, at 12 noon. Friends and family may call at the funeral home Wednesday May 4 from 6-8 pm or Thursday 1 hour prior to the service. Burial will be in Immaculate Conception Cemetery.

Memorial contributions may be made to Northern Chesapeake Hospice Foundation c/o the funeral home. To send condolences visit www.rtfoard.com.
